Synthetic scale-up of a novel fluorescent probe and its biological evaluation for surface detection of Staphylococcus aureus.

TLDR
The LGX fluorometric test for enzymatic MRSA/MSSA detection is reported on, highlighting the reasons rhodamines have been overlooked and also strategies to improve the synthesis of rhodamine-peptide conjugates.
